I love this dress by Maggy London because it isn't your typical palm leaf print. I love the bright colors that are mixed in, and that it's in a sophisticated silhouette -- the classic sheath dress. The sheath, much like a shift dress, is flattering on a variety of body-types and it's a silhouette that is timeless and never goes out of style. Maggy London always does a great job of mixing trends with classic silhouettes. The quality of her dresses is amazing too. There isn't one that I own that I don't love.
